Web users could win a £1 million, 17-bedroom luxury hotel in Scotland by buying a £6 raffle ticket.
The current owners of the Kimberley Hotel in Oban, Argyll, apparently feel like retiring and are looking for a worth successor. Rather bizarrely, they've decided the best way to do this is to dispose of the hotel in an internet prize draw.
To enter the competition you need to hand over 10 Euros (around £6) and in return you'll get a symbolic roof slate from the hotel and an entry into the raffle.
The owners aim to sell 350,000 tiles by 30th March. If they don't sell enough tiles the draw won't take place and no money will change hands. If all goes well the draw will be broadcast live on the internet on April 13th 2003 and the owners will have netted themselves over £2 million.
The winner of the Kimberley will have to run the hotel for at least a year and has to honour the jobs of the four members of staff working there. 20 runners up will win a week's stay for two at the hotel.
